5.1.c CT input
CT
18
19
To enable CT input, modify parameter 287 ct F.
Input for 50 mA amperometric transformer.
Sampling time 100 ms.
Configurable by parameters.

5.1.e Serial input
RS485
Shield/Schermo
(B)
(A)
21
20
Modbus RS485 communication.
RTU Slave with galvanic insulation.
It is recommended to use the twisted and shielded cable for communica-
tions.
5.1.f Digital output
0V
DO1
(PNP)
DO2
(PNP)
9
10
19
Digital output PNP (including SSR) for command or alarm.
Range 12 VDC/25 mA or 24 VDC/15mA selectable by parameter 282
v.out.
5.1.g Analogue output AO1
AO1
V/mA
12
11
Linear output in mA or V (galvanically isolated) configurable as command,
alarm or retransmission of process-setpoint.
The selection mA or Volt for the linear output depends on the parameters
configuration.
